| Fontanelle is the second studio album by American punk rock band Babes in Toyland, which was originally released in 1992. After extensive touring throughout 1991, the band entered the studio to record their major label follow-up to their debut album Spanking Machine. The album was co-produced by Kat Bjelland with Lee Ranaldo (Sonic Youth) heading production and was mixed by Dave Ogilvie. Fontanelle is Babes in Toyland's most critically and commercially successful album.
